//! Adaptive Auto-Tuning System for Ultimate Performance Optimization
//!
//! This module provides an intelligent auto-tuning system that continuously
//! optimizes performance parameters based on runtime characteristics, hardware
//! capabilities, workload patterns, and environmental conditions. It uses
//! machine learning techniques to predict optimal configurations and adapt
//! to changing performance requirements dynamically.

    fn calculate_stability_score(&self, measurements: &[PerformanceMeasurement]) -> f64 {
        if measurements.len() < 2 {
            return 1.0;
        }

        let scores: Vec<f64> = measurements.iter().map(|m| m.score).collect();
        let mean = scores.iter().sum::<f64>() / scores.len() as f64;
        let variance = scores.iter().map(|s| (s - mean).powi(2)).sum::<f64>() / scores.len() as f64;
        let std_dev = variance.sqrt();

        // Higher stability means lower coefficient of variation
        if mean > 0.0 {
            1.0 - (std_dev / mean).min(1.0)
        } else {
            0.0
        }
    }
